When to Call a Professional for Air Conditioner Repair

Within the scorching heat of summer, few things provide as much respite as a well-functioning air conditioner. However, like all home equipment, air conditioners are prone to wear and tear, which can lead to malfunctions and breakdowns. While some minor points may be resolved with fundamental bothershooting, there are occasions when it’s imperative to call a professional for air conditioner repair. Understanding when to seek professional help can save you time, cash, and make sure the longevity of your cooling system.

Weak Airflow or Insufficient Cooling: In case you discover weak airflow or your air conditioner is failing to chill your space adequately, it may indicate several underlying issues. Clogged air filters, blocked ducts, or malfunctioning compressor units are frequent culprits. Making an attempt to diagnose and fix these problems without adequate knowledge and tools can additional damage your system. A professional technician can accurately diagnose the issue and implement the mandatory repairs to restore optimal performance.

Unusual Sounds or Odors: Strange sounds akin to grinding, banging, or squealing coming from your air conditioner are clear indicators of trouble. Equally, foul odors emanating from the unit could signal mold development or electrical issues. Ignoring these signs and persevering with to operate the air conditioner can exacerbate the problem and pose safety hazards. Calling a professional on the first sign of unusual noises or odors can prevent additional damage and ensure the safety of your home environment.

Frequent Cycling On and Off: If your air conditioner incessantly cycles on and off, known as brief cycling, it not only compromises comfort but also signifies an underlying issue. Short cycling might be caused by numerous factors, including refrigerant leaks, thermostat problems, or an oversized unit. Attempting DIY repairs without addressing the foundation cause can worsen the problem and improve energy consumption. A professional HVAC technician can accurately diagnose the issue and recommend appropriate options to stop additional brief cycling.

Leaking or Moisture Buildup: Any signs of water leakage or moisture buildup around your air conditioner ought to be addressed promptly. Leaks can stem from clogged condensate drains, refrigerant leaks, or malfunctioning components. Moisture buildup can lead to mold progress, structural damage, and electrical hazards if left unchecked. A professional technician can establish the supply of the leak, repair it, and make sure that your air conditioner operates safely and efficiently.

Tripped Circuit Breakers or Blown Fuses: In case your air conditioner repeatedly journeys the circuit breaker or blows fuses, it indicates an electrical problem that requires fast attention. Continuing to reset the breaker or replace fuses without addressing the underlying problem may end up in electrical damage and even fire hazards. A professional HVAC technician can inspect the electrical parts of your air conditioner, determine any faulty wiring or connections, and perform the necessary repairs to restore safe operation.

Old or Outdated System: In case your air conditioner is nearing the top of its anticipated lifespan or is outdated in terms of technology and efficiency, it may be more prone to breakdowns and inefficiencies. Investing in common upkeep and timely repairs can prolong the lifespan of your unit, but there comes a degree when replacement turns into the more price-efficient option. A professional HVAC technician can assess the condition of your air conditioner, provide recommendations for repairs or replacement, and make sure that you make an informed determination based mostly on your wants and budget.

In conclusion, while some minor air conditioner points may be resolved via DIY troubleshooting, certain signs require the expertise of a professional HVAC technician. From weak airflow and weird sounds to frequent biking and electrical problems, knowing when to call a professional for air conditioner repair is essential for sustaining comfort, safety, and effectivity in your home. By addressing issues promptly and relying on professional experience, you may make sure that your air conditioner operates reliably throughout the sweltering summer months.
